What's the difference between 5th Avenue NYC Love and Classique?+
5th Avenue NYC Love is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Elizabeth Arden (2022) dominated by Floral accords. Classique is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Jean Paul Gaultier (1993) leaning on White Floral accords. They share 4 accords: Floral, White Floral, Citrus, Sweet.
